===Possible coalition after the 2024 general election=== After the [[2023 United Kingdom local elections|2023 local elections]], in which both Labour and Liberal Democrats made gains. Both [[Keir Starmer]], the Labour leader, and [[Ed Davey]], the Liberal Democrat leader, refused to rule out a possible alliance after the [[2024 United Kingdom general election|2024 general election]].<ref>{{cite news|last1=Adu|first1=Aletha|last2=Walker|first2=Peter|url=https://www.theguardian.com/politics/2023/may/09/keir-starmer-refuses-to-rule-out-lib-dem-coalition-after-next-election|title=Keir Starmer refuses to rule out Lib Dem coalition after next election|date=9 May 2023|website=The Guardian|access-date=10 May 2023}}</ref> On 13 June 2023, [[Labour Party (UK)|Labour Party National Campaign Coordinator]] [[Shabana Mahmood]] ruled out a Lib–Lab pact in the by-elections in [[2023 Mid Bedfordshire by-election|Mid Bedfordshire]], [[2023 Uxbridge and South Ruislip by-election|Uxbridge and South Ruislip]] and [[2023 Selby and Ainsty by-election|Selby and Ainsty]].<ref>{{Cite web |last=Gye |first=Chloe Chaplain, Hugo |date=2023-06-13 |title=Labour rules out Lib Dem pact and aims to win three by-elections - including Dorries's old seat |url=https://inews.co.uk/news/politics/labour-rules-out-lib-dem-pact-win-three-by-elections-dorries-mid-beds-2407386 |access-date=2023-06-15 |website=The Independent |language=en}}</ref>
